How Electric Cellulite Massagers Work
Electric cellulite massagers use mechanical stimulation to temporarily improve circulation, support lymphatic drainage, and smooth the appearance of uneven skin texture.
Roller Massage Technology
Rotating rollers create continuous tissue stimulation that helps loosen tight fascia and improve blood flow. Roller systems are often the most comfortable option for beginners.
Vacuum Suction Technology
Vacuum devices lift and manipulate tissue through suction, providing a deeper massage effect than traditional roller systems while encouraging temporary fluid movement.
Electric Cupping Technology
Electric cupping devices combine suction and massage to target stubborn cellulite-prone areas while offering adjustable intensity levels for different skin sensitivities.
Percussion and Deep Tissue Massage
Percussion systems deliver rapid pulses that help relax muscles and increase circulation beneath the skin. They are commonly used for muscle recovery as well as cellulite-focused routines.
What Research Says About Cellulite Reduction
Research suggests massage-based therapies may temporarily improve the appearance of cellulite by increasing circulation and reducing fluid retention. Results vary significantly between individuals and require consistent use to maintain visible improvements.

Do Electric Cellulite Massagers Really Work?
Electric cellulite massagers can help improve the appearance of cellulite, but they should not be viewed as permanent cellulite removal solutions.
Realistic Expectations
Most users experience temporary improvements in skin smoothness and circulation rather than complete cellulite elimination.
Temporary vs Long-Term Results
Results typically depend on consistency, body composition, hydration, and overall lifestyle habits. Visible improvements often fade when treatments stop.
